Producing a parrot-safe environment is crucial. Guarantee that your home is without hazards such as hazardous plants, open windows, and small things that can be swallowed. A quiet corner with sufficient sunlight and area for flying is perfect.

Before purchasing a parrot, ensure you have a basic understanding of avian health. Parrots can be prone to different illness, and it's crucial to purchase from a source that offers health clearances. Search for indications of a healthy parrot, such as intense eyes, tidy plumes, and active behavior.

Parrots prosper on social interaction. Hang out with your parrot daily, engage in play, and think about supplying a companion bird if you're away typically. Remember, neglecting a parrot's social requirements can cause behavioral concerns.

FAQs1. How long do parrots live?
The life expectancy of a parrot differs by types. Smaller sized species like budgerigars may live 5-10 years, while larger types like macaws can measure up to 50 years or more.
2. Do parrots need a companion?
While some parrots are completely pleased as single birds, others love a buddy. This depends upon the species and private personality.
3. Are parrots good pets for children?
Numerous parrots can be fantastic animals for older children who understand how to manage them carefully. Always monitor interactions between kids and birds.
4. Can parrots learn to talk?
Yes, lots of parrot types, especially African Greys and Amazons, are understood for [Afrikanische Papageien Kaufen](https://graupapagei-zu-verkaufen30062.national-wiki.com/2238845/12_companies_leading_the_way_in_buy_a_parrot) their capability to imitate human speech. Nevertheless, not all parrots will talk, and talking ability can differ widely.
5. What should I do if my parrot reveals signs of illness?
If you notice any uncommon behavior, such as lethargy, changes in consuming routines, or unusual droppings, call a bird veterinarian immediately.
